Information:

THE INITIAL CHECK.
Check for active diagnostic codes. Check for other flashing indicators on the GSC. If any codes are present, correct the diagnostic codes first. Go to the appropriate procedure for that fault.Expected Result:No other diagnostic codes or indicators are active.Results:
OK - No other diagnostic codes or indicators are active. Proceed to Test Step 2.
NOT OK - Another diagnostic code is active or an indicator is active.Repair: Exit this procedure. Troubleshoot the active code or troubleshoot the indicator. Stop.Test Step 2. INSPECT THE FUEL AND AIR SUPPLY.
Check the fuel level and quality. Refer to the Engine Service Manual.
Check for a plugged fuel filter. Refer to the Engine Service Manual.
Check for a plugged air filter. Refer to the Engine Service Manual.Expected Result:The air and fuel systems are within specifications.Results:
OK - The air and fuel systems are within specifications. Proceed to Test Step 3.
NOT OK - One or more of the items in this Test Step are NOT within specifications.Repair: Correct the problem with the corresponding system. Reset the genset. Operate the genset and verify that the problem has been corrected. Stop.Test Step 3. CHECK THE FUSES.
Check the fuses "F2" and "F4" on the relay module.Expected Result:The fuse is NOT blown.Results:
OK - The fuse is NOT blown. Proceed to Test Step 4.
NOT OK - The fuse is blown. Proceed to Test Step 12.Test Step 4. CHECK THE SETPOINTS.
View the setpoints P17 and P18. Make a note of the setpoints. See System Operation, "Engine/Generator Setpoint Viewing OP2". Compare the setpoints against the default setpoints of the particular generator set.Expected Result:The setpoints are correct. The factory default values are 90 seconds for P17 and 10 seconds for P18.Results:
OK - The setpoints are correct. Proceed to Test Step 5.
NOT OK - The setpoints are NOT correct.Repair: Reprogram the setpoints. Reset the genset. Operate the genset and verify that the problem has been corrected. Stop.Test Step 5. CHECK THE BATTERY VOLTAGE.
The engine should be off.
Measure the system voltage at the battery.Expected Result:For 24 volt systems, the voltage should be from 24.8 to 29.5 DCV. For 32 volt systems, the voltage should be from 33.1 to 39.3 DCV.Results:
OK - The voltage is correct. Proceed to Test Step 6.
NOT OK - The battery voltage is NOT within specifications.Repair: Further testing of the battery system is necessary. See Testing And Adjusting, "CID 168 Electrical System". Stop.Test Step 6. CHECK THE ENGINE STARTING FUNCTION.Note: The GSC is attempting to crank whenever the K4 indicator is ON. The K4 indicator is located on the lower display. Be aware of the 10 second crank cycle (set by P18)that is factory set. Be sure that the K4 indicator is ON while you are making the following measurements. More than one start may be required to complete this test.
Disconnect the "B+" wire on the pinion solenoid of the starting motor. Do not allow the "B+" wire connection to contact the frame or other metal components. The "B+" wire remains disconnected for all of the remaining steps of this procedure.
